Choice Hotels International Reports a 10% Increase in Third Quarter EBITDA from Franchising Activities
October 30, 2015 9:00 AM EDTROCKVILLE, Md., Oct. 30,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- Choice Hotels International, Inc. (NYSE: CHH) today reported the following highlights for the third quarter 2015:
Rev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2015 totaled $241.5 million, an increase of 12 percent from the same period of 2014. Ear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ization ("EBITDA") from franchising activities for the three months ended September 30, 2015, totaled $81.1 million, an increase of 10 percent from the same period of 2014.
